    Toilet doesn't always flush and sometimes there is a sewer smell
    Two year old condo we have downstairs unit on slab. Recently just flushing clear water will sometimes take two flushes. Water always goes down but sometime there is no strong push on first try. Periodically we get a sewer smell. The toilet sits tight (no rocking). I've tried bleach as well as using bleach in sink and tub. I've even poured down hot water from a bucket (that always works). The sink & tub do not appear to have a problem. All other sinks and bathrooms work fine.

    Sometimes the wax ring gets flattened out and even though it won't leak because the horn in far enough down, when the wind blows, it will leak air out under the toilet bottom. As a test, caulk the floor joint. If the smell goes away, replace the wax ring. I do not permanently caulk the botton in case the toilet leaks since you might not see it and water will saturate the floor.
